Which Key Documents Are Necessary for Your Home Loan Application?

To successfully apply for a home loan in Beaufort West, you must prepare thoroughly and understand the documentation required. Organising your paperwork effectively is essential to streamline the application process. The crucial documents typically needed include proof of income, bank statements, and relevant details about the property you intend to purchase. By compiling these documents ahead of time, potential borrowers can greatly reduce the chances of facing delays and complications during the application. Here is a comprehensive list of documents you should gather before starting your application:
- Proof of income (such as payslips or tax returns)
- Employment verification letter
- Bank statements for the past three months
- Identity document (ID)
- Property information (including deed of sale or offer to purchase)
- Credit report
- Proof of additional income (if applicable)
- Affordability assessment documentation

How Do Loan Terms Impact Interest Rates?
The length of a home loan, commonly referred to as the loan term, has a significant effect on the interest rates that lenders offer in Beaufort West. Shorter loan terms usually attract lower interest rates but entail higher monthly payments, making them suitable for borrowers who can manage larger repayments. Conversely, longer loan terms generally lead to higher interest rates but lower monthly payments, appealing to those prioritising cash flow over total interest expenses. Understanding these dynamics helps borrowers make informed choices that align with their financial capabilities.
How Does Your Down Payment Size Affect Loan Rates?
The amount of your down payment significantly influences interest rates for entry-level homes in Beaufort West. A larger deposit can reduce the total loan amount and lower the perceived risk for lenders, often leading to more favourable interest rates. For instance, providing a deposit of 20% or more can lead to substantial savings over the life of the loan. In contrast, smaller deposits may result in higher interest rates due to increased lender risk. Understanding this relationship is crucial for first-time buyers aiming to secure the best possible terms.

What Hidden Fees Should You Be Aware Of in Loan Agreements?
Hidden fees in home loan agreements can catch many borrowers in Beaufort West off guard. Commonly overlooked costs include application fees, valuation fees, and penalties for early repayment. Conducting thorough research and asking lenders about potential fees ensures that you make well-informed decisions, allowing you to understand the full financial implications of your loan agreements.

Frequently Asked Questions
What Is the Minimum Deposit Required for a Home Loan in Beaufort West?
The standard minimum deposit for a home loan in Beaufort West generally falls between 10% and 20% of the property’s purchase price, although this may vary based on the lender and specific loan products.
How Long Does It Take to Process a Home Loan Application?
The processing time for a home loan application in Beaufort West can vary from a few days to several weeks, depending on the lender and the complexity of your application.
Can You Apply for a Home Loan with Poor Credit?
While it is possible to apply for a home loan with poor credit, it may result in higher interest rates or potential rejection. Improving your credit score before applying can enhance your chances of approval.
What Additional Costs Should You Consider When Buying a Home?
Beyond the home loan itself, buyers should account for costs such as transfer duty, legal fees, home insurance, and maintenance expenses, as these can significantly impact the overall budget.
